Does it work if you use rndc reload? I think the use of signals to control
named is now deprecated in BIND 9. named might be completely ignoring your HUP.

(And, by the way, it shouldn't matter whether you increment the serial number
or not; either the master reloads the zone or it doesn't, the serial number
only dictates whether slaves replicate a new copy of the zone).

> I have a bind9 server which uses the INCLUDE directive to load a "common"
> portion of a Zone file (the header including serial number and several A
> host records), and then 2 separate portions of the zone file, one for
> internal host lookups and one for external lookups.
>
> I've noticed that when I make changes to the common portion of the zone file
> and then -HUP named, it does not re-read the zone file(s). (and yes, I made
> sure to change the serial number).
